    Snack advice: trail mix, 2 to 1 ratio nuts to fruit, gives you fast and slow burning energy and prevents low blood sugar(which I’ve been through and it sucks), and I’d avoid caffeine or energy drinks for the reasons mentioned also because it can make you antsy. I recommend Gatorade or Powerade. Those electolytes are precious. And like Linda says this is only my experience everyone is different.

    On the note of packing things, bring water and sweet stuff! or like something with electrolytes in it. If you're going to be sitting for more than two hours or so, you want to keep your blood sugar at a constant level. During your tattoo session, your body is burning more energy (sugar) in fighting off foreign invader (ink, potential germs, etc.) and if you aren't replenishing on some thing heavy in carbs/sugars then you'll easily go hypoglycemic (low blood sugar) and can pass out. You want to keep hydrated throughout your tattoo session because you're inadvertently sweating, bleeding, burning energy, so to have water or something like a Gatorade (something with electrolytes - salt) helps in keeping your blood pressure up, so you don't pass out.
